An FHA loan is a mortgage loan that’s backed by the Federal Housing Administration. Borrowers are required to pay a mortgage insurance premium, which reduces the lender’s risk if a borrower defaults.

Fha Home Mortgage Loans Home buyers who use fha loans pay an upfront mortgage insurance premium (MIP) of 1.75 percent. Borrowers also pay a modest ongoing fee with each monthly payment, which depends on the risk the FHA takes with your loan. Shorter-term loans, smaller balances, and larger down payments result in lower monthly insurance costs.
